Abstract
The invention discloses a kind of gardens implement, including compartment, the car body top is connected with skylight by headstock gear, the headstock gear includes the lower guideway for being fixed on top outside compartment, upper rail and driving cylinder, the lower guideway and upper rail are parallel to each other and are set along car length direction, the upper rail is equipped with two and is symmetrically set in compartment both sides, the lower guideway is equipped with two and is symmetrically set in compartment both sides, one first draw runner is respectively equipped with two upper rails, the both ends of first draw runner are respectively equipped with go forward rotation axis and upper rear rotation axis, it is described go forward rotation axis and it is upper after rotation axis respectively by the first roller roll be connected to the upper rail.The headstock gear of the skylight of the present invention is reasonable in design, and skylight can be opened completely, convenient to carry out operation;Two power tools of apparatus for work can alternately operating, realize Multi-Tasking function, improve work efficiency, simplify equipment.

Closure state is in for the headstock gear of skylight as shown in Figures 2 and 3, the second roller is located at vertical rail section at this time
Lower end at;As shown in figure 4, the output terminal for starting driving cylinder is shunk, supporting rod is driven to move backward, therefore the first draw runner
And then moved backward along upper rail, so as to drive the first rotating bar and the second rotating bar to rotate synchronously, the second roller is along vertical rail
Road section upward sliding, drives skylight to move straight up;As shown in figure 5, the output terminal of driving cylinder is further shunk, the second rolling
Take turns and horizontal rail section is entered after vertical rail section, the open portion in skylight and compartment completely disengages, and does not interfere with each other, and reaches
To maximum opening.After skylight fully opens, convenient working personnel have carried out observation and operation.

Anti-rust metal coating is coated on the upper rail surface, the anti-rust metal coating includes the original of following parts by weight meter
Material:It is 20 parts of ammonium lauryl sulfate, 10 parts of ribonucleoside triphosphote, 35 parts of titanium dioxide, 25 parts of polyethylene polyamine, 5 parts of sebacic acid, different
15 parts of Propanolamine, 40 parts of sulfited oil, 25 parts of octadecyl alcolol phosphoric acid ester sodium, 10 parts of polyester urethane, divinyl four
30 parts of amine, 30 parts of tert-butyl group anthraquinone, 20 parts of surfactant, surfactant is petroleum sodium sulfonate.
The molecular weight of polyester urethane is 20000, Tg is 0 DEG C, hydroxyl value 10mgKOH/g.Surfactant is
Petroleum sodium sulfonate.
The preparation method of above-mentioned anti-rust metal coating, comprises the following steps:
(1) ammonium lauryl sulfate, ribonucleoside triphosphote, titanium dioxide, polyethylene polyamine are uniformly mixed, then add ten
Eight alcohol phosphoric acid ester sodiums, polyester urethane, are heated to reacting 20min at 80 DEG C;
(2) sebacic acid, isopropanolamine, sulfited oil, divinyl tetramine, tert-butyl group anthraquinone, surfactant are added
Dissolved in 30 DEG C of water, then add the mixture of step (1), stir evenly.
The mixing speed of step (2) is 400r/min, mixing time 20min.The rust-preventing characteristic of the anti-rust metal coating
Can be good, good combination property is applied widely.
